Assexmarkets Information

Assexmarkets is an unregulated broker, offering trading on forex CFD, commodities, indices and crypto CFD with leverage up to 1:500 and spread from 0.2 pips on MT5 trading platform. The minimum deposit requirement is $1.

How is the fund security of Assexmarkets evaluated?

The evaluation of fund security is highly problematic, as Assexmarkets Global Ltd operates as an unregulated entity. WikiFX data indicates an overall score of 1.26, which reflects a severe lack of regulatory safeguards. There is no formal oversight mechanism for client fund segregation or investor compensation schemes, presenting a fundamental risk to trader capital that requires independent due diligence.

Which financial regulator oversees Assexmarkets?

Assexmarkets is not overseen by any recognized financial regulator. The firm, Assexmarkets Global Ltd, is based in Saint Lucia and does not hold any valid forex trading licenses from major authorities such as the FCA, ASIC, or CySEC. It operates entirely outside the framework of credible regulatory oversight.

What factors should I consider when choosing a safe forex broker?

When choosing a safe broker, investors should focus on key factors such as regulatory qualifications, fund security, and trading transparency. In general, priority should be given to platforms regulated by major regulatory authorities, such as the Financial Conduct Authority,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, and the Australian Securities and Investments Commission. At the same time, attention should also be paid to: whether client funds are kept in segregated accounts, whether the fee structure is transparent, and whether there are many negative complaints or withdrawal problems. What does it mean if a broker holds multiple regulatory licenses?

If a broker holds multiple regulatory licenses, it usually means that it operates in multiple countries or regions and needs to comply with the requirements of different regulatory authorities. Its overall credibility is generally higher. However, it should be noted that regulatory strength differs between licenses. Some offshore regulations have weaker restrictions, so safety should not be judged only by the number of licenses. It is recommended to focus on whether the broker holds licenses from major regulators such as FCA or ASIC, and evaluate its regulatory status, historical records, and overall rating together. How can I determine if a forex broker is regulated?

To determine whether a broker is regulated, the key is to verify whether it holds a valid financial license. Investors can check the license number and status through the official websites of regulatory authorities (such as Financial Conduct Authority, Australian Securities and Investments Commission) to confirm whether the license is real and under valid supervision. It should be noted that some brokers may engage in license cloning or unauthorized operations, meaning they use another company's license or provide services in regions where they are not authorized. These situations also involve risks. What is a clone broker website?

A cloned broker website refers to a fraudulent website that imitates the information of a legitimate broker. Such websites usually copy the real company's brand name, page design, and even regulatory information to mislead investors into making deposits. Common features include: a domain name highly similar to the official website (such as slight spelling differences), abnormal or unverifiable contact information, and promises of unusually high returns. Once funds enter such platforms, they are usually difficult to recover.
